The foundations of empathy can be laid in the earliest years. Our free annual webinar is a resource for anybody living and working with young children. It looks at how empathy grows in the early years and the role that adults and stories can play in its development.

The 2022 Early Years Webinar

This year's webinar featured Sue Palmer, literacy specialist, writer and presenter and Chair of Upstart Scotland; June O'Sullivan MBE, CEO of the London Early Years Foundation and author and illustrator Nadia Shireen whose picture book Barbara Throws A Wobbler is in the 2022 #ReadforEmpathy Collection. It was chaired by EmpathyLab co-founder and Programme Manager for Libraries Connected, Sarah Mears.
